Steps to reproduce:

  1. Install OIDC plugin
  2. Run bunx @better-auth/cli generate
  3. Check generated SQL. None of the oauth* tables contain foreign key references.

The docs mention FK references should be there, cf. d3c9496a72/docs/content/docs/plugins/oidc-provider.mdx (L384)

The schema has no references defined though: 577cfb4ab3/packages/better-auth/src/plugins/oidc-provider/schema.ts

I understand the schema is incomplete, but just wanted to raise the issue to confirm expectations before opening a PR with the fix.

You're correct—the OIDC plugin schema currently does not define foreign key references for its oauth* tables, even though the documentation suggests they should be present. This isn't intentional; it's an incomplete implementation and not a design decision. There are no technical blockers for adding FK references, but be aware that some features like Trusted Clients previously required removing certain constraints, and the system doesn't enforce them right now—so double-check for edge cases if you add them source.

Recent improvements elsewhere in Better Auth have added FK references and onDelete cascade behavior to other tables, and maintainers have acknowledged the schema is incomplete and intend to fix it source. A PR to add FK references to the OIDC schema would be appropriate and likely welcomed. For best practices, use explicit .references() methods in your schema definitions, as seen in other parts of the codebase source.
